Automatic Reasoning (Automatické Uvažování a používání nástrojů ART)

Prompt Engineering Bře 30, 2024

Automatic Reasoning and Tool-use (ART) je rámec, který rovněž využívá zmrazené modely ke generování mezikroků uvažování jako program.

Přístup ART silně připomíná princip agentů, tedy dekompozici problému a využití nástrojů pro každý dekomponovaný krok.

Pomocí ART zmrazený LLM rozkládá instance nové úlohy na více kroků, přičemž využívá externí nástroje, kdykoli je to vhodné.

ART je přístup bez nutnosti jemného dolaďování, který umožňuje automatizovat vícekrokové uvažování a automatický výběr a použití nástrojů.

Kombinace podnětů a nástrojů CoT ve vzájemné návaznosti se ukázala jako silný a robustní přístup k řešení mnoha úloh s LLM. Tyto přístupy obvykle vyžadují ruční tvorbu demonstrací specifických pro danou úlohu a pečlivě skriptované prokládání generování modelů s používáním nástrojů. Paranjape a další, (2023) navrhují nový rámec, který využívá zmrazený LLM k automatickému generování mezikroků uvažování jako program.

ART funguje následujícím způsobem:

  • Při zadání nové úlohy vybere z knihovny úloh ukázky vícekrokového uvažování a použití nástrojů.
  • v době testování pozastaví generování, kdykoli jsou zavolány externí nástroje, a integruje jejich výstupy, než pokračuje v generování.

ART vybízí model k tomu, aby na základě demonstrací zobecnil novou úlohu a použil nástroje na vhodných místech, a to nulovým způsobem. Kromě toho je systém ART rozšiřitelný, protože také umožňuje lidem opravovat chyby v krocích uvažování nebo přidávat nové nástroje jednoduchou aktualizací knihoven úloh a nástrojů. Postup je demonstrován níže (zdroj):

VM

Osobní inforrmace

Napsat komentář

Vaše e-mailová adresa nebude zveřejněna. Vyžadované informace jsou označeny *